COVID-19 spike forces Butte-Silver Bow non-essential government buildings to close to in-person business

BUTTE — Butte-Silver Bow announced Tuesday that due to the uptick in COVID-19 cases in our area, all non-essential government buildings will once again close to in-person business beginning on Nov. 12.

Butte-Silver Bow’s offices will remain staffed with employees who will continue to offer their full range of services online or by phone and email weekdays from 8 a.m. until 5 p.m.

There will be drop boxes for payments and other documentation in front of the Courthouse at 155 West Granite Street and the Water Utility Building at 124 West Granite Street.

Essential services such as those performed by The Butte-Silver Bow Fire Department, Police Department, Public Works Department, and Health Department will continue to be fully operational.

Based on our Health Department’s directive, it is imperative at this time to keep both our employees and citizens safe by limiting in-person contact.
